Hur utvecklas den svenska minröjningsfunktionen inom marinen?

Arby, Nathaniel January 2009 (has links)
Sjöminan har sänkt och skadat mer tonnage än alla andra vapensystem till sjöss. Då medel föder motmedel har sjöminan och minröjningen följt varandra i en lång duell. Huvudsyftet med denna uppsats är att undersöka hur de svenska minröjningsförbanden utvecklas inom taktik och teknik och hur dessa komponenter förhåller sig till varandra. Uppsatsen söker även svaret på hur utvecklingen från minröjningsklass Landsort till minröjningsklass Koster skett. Med hjälp av deskriptiv metod kommer Militärstrategisk doktrin, Doktrin för marina operationer samt Försvarsmaktens läroböcker i Mineringstjänst, Minmotmedelstjänst och Minröjningstjänst att användas för att redogöra hur den marina taktiken och tekniken utvecklas som ett medel i duellen mot sjöminan. De svenska minröjningsfartygens taktiska och tekniska utveckling grundar sig på de militära basfunktionerna, ledning, verkan, skydd, rörelse, underrättelse samt uthållighet. Samtidigt utvecklas minröjningsförbanden i Försvarsmakten mot ett, både för personal och materiel, säkrare och effektivare förband. / The main purpose with this essay is to examine the development of the Swedish mine warfare branch both tactical and technical and how these two components are combined to maximize the effect. The essay also analyses the midlife upgrade of the MCMV Landsort class towards the MCMV Koster class. This essay will describe on the basis of the Swedish doctrines and mine warfare textbooks how the naval tactics and technology function as a foundation for development of new means in the duel against the sea mine. The sea mine is a weapon system that has been used during several centuries and has sunk more tonnage than all other weapon systems together. As long as there have been sea mines, there has also existed its counterpart, the mine counter measures. The Swedish MCMV’s technological and tactical developments strive towards fulfilling the six mandatory functions in warfare, command, effect, protection, mobility, intelligence and endurance. The modern MCMV develops toward a more secure and efficient unit.

A dimensão espacial do direito à cidade: acesso à equipamentos públicos e infraestrutura no Programa Minha Casa Minha Vida na Região Metropolitana de Salvador (2009 - 2015)

Tosta, Aline Oliveira 11 1900 (has links)

No. of bitstreams: 1 DISSERTACAO_ALINE TOSTA.pdf: 14475747 bytes, checksum: 2d3ae32a6858e7797fa700a4d57848d1 (MD5) / A história das cidades brasileiras é marcada por um intenso processo de urbanização impulsionado principalmente pelas atividades industriais. A precariedade do morar é uma das principais consequências desse processo. A política habitacional do país pode ser caracterizada pelos inúmeros programas habitacionais lançados, pela dificuldade de integração entre as políticas públicas e por ignorar a questão espacial no processo de gestão e planejamento das cidades. O resultado é a produção de moradias desconectadas da vida urbana, segregadas espacialmente e manutenção da negação do direito à cidade. O problema habitacional brasileiro e a negação do direito à cidade são temas amplos e complexos que refletem uma dimensão espacial que precisa ser aprofundada. Sendo assim, a presente pesquisa trás como contribuição para a discussão desse tema, a análise de um desses aspectos. Trata-se da atuação do Programa Minha Casa Minha Vida na Região Metropolitana de Salvador (2009 - 2015), com um enfoque na sua dimensão espacial e no atendimento do direito à cidade, utilizando como ferramenta de representação espacial o Sistema de Informações Geográficas - SIG. / The history of Brazilian cities is marked by an intense urbanization process mainly driven by industrial activities; and the precariousness of living is one of the main consequences of this process. The housing policy of the country can be characterized by the existence of many housing programs, by the difficulty of integration between public policies and by ignoring the spatial dilemma in the process of management and planning of cities. The result is a housing production detached from urban life, spatially segregated, keeping the denial of the right to the city. The housing problem in Brazil and the denial to the city are wide, complex themes which reflect a spatial dimension in need of a deeper thought. Thus, the purpose of this research is to bring an analysis of one of these aspects as a contribution to the topic. This research aims to study the performance of Programa Minha Casa, Minha Vida in the metropolitan area of Salvador de Bahia (2009-2015), with an emphasis on its spatial dimension and the fulfillment of right to the city, using GIS (Geographic Information System) as a tool for spatial representation.

Prozessierung des pp89 MCMV MHC Klasse I Epitops durch das Proteasom

Voigt, Antje 20 April 2004 (has links)
Das Proteasom ist eine ATP- abhängige Protease, die sich aus vielen Untereinheiten zusammensetzt. Es ist für die Generierung der MHC Klasse I- restringierten Peptide verantwortlich, die im Folgenden auf der Zelloberfläche präsentiert werden. Nicht-funktionelle Proteine, die als so genannte defective ribosomal products (DRIP) bezeichnet werden, stellen eine wichtige Quelle für die Generierung von antigenen Peptiden, insbesondere jedoch von viralen Peptiden dar. Generell wird die Lehrmeinung vertreten, dass der Abbau von polyubiquitinierten Proteinen durch das 26S Proteasom zur Generierung von MHC Klasse I- Liganden führt. Allerdings ist weiterhin unklar, ob virale Proteine Ubiquitin- abhängig vom Proteasom abgebaut werden. Demnach sollte im Rahmen dieser Arbeit der Proteasom- abhängige Abbau des mCMV ie pp89 Proteins vor allem hinsichtlich einer Ubiquitinierung untersucht werden. Folglich wurden Konstrukte sowohl für ein rekombinantes pp89 (rek pp89) als auch für ein ODCpp89 Fusionsprotein entworfen. Somit konnten sowohl der in vitro Abbau dieser Proteine als auch die Prozessierung des spezifischen MHC Klasse I H2-Ld Epitops verfolgt werden. Experimente zum Nachweis von Ubiquitin- Protein- Konjugaten wurden in vivo mit stabil transfizierten Mausfibroblasten (B8 Zellen) durchgeführt. Die experimentellen Daten sprechen für einen schnellen in vitro Abbau des rek pp89 durch das 20S Proteasom. Das MHC Klasse I pp89 Epitop bzw. dessen 11mer Precursorpeptid wurden dabei mit hoher Präzision generiert. Spezifische CTL Assays weisen auf die Generierung des korrekten Epitops bzw. des Precursors hin. Nach Verdau des ODCpp89 Fusionsproteins durch 26S Proteasomen in Anwesenheit von Antizym konnten mit diesem Test ebenfalls das 9mer Epitop respektive das 11mer des pp89 nachgewiesen werden. Eine potentielle Ubiquitinierung des pp89 wurde in vivo in Zellkulturen untersucht. Nach Gabe von Proteasomeninhibitoren zu Mausfibroblasten konnte eine starke Akkumulierung von Ubiquitin- Konjugaten beobachtet werden. Allerdings konnte in den verschiedenen Versuchsansätzen kein Nachweis von pp89- Ubiquitin- Konjugaten erbracht werden. Demzufolge ist für die Generierung von viralen Epitopen ein Proteasom- abhängiger, aber Ubiquitin- unabhängiger Abbauweg denkbar. / The proteasome, an ATP-dependent, multisubunit protease, is responsible for the generation of most MHC class I restricted epitopes presented on the cell surface. Non-functional proteins, also known as defectice ribosomal products (DRiP), represent an important source for the generation of antigenic peptides in general and of viral epitopes in particular. It is widely accepted that the degradation of polyubiquitinated proteins by the 26S proteasome is a prerequisite for the generation of MHC class I ligands. However, the ubiquitin dependence for the proteasomal degradation of viral proteins is an issue so far unresolved. Therefore, the aim of this study was to analyze the proteasomal degradation of the mCMV ie pp89 in respect to an anticipated ubiquitinylation. Thus, a recombinant pp89 (recpp89) as well as an ODCpp89 fusion protein were generated. The in vitro processing of these proteins and the generation of a MHC class I H2-Ld epitope by proteasomes was further studied. Murine fibroblast cell lines (B8 cells) were used to analyze any in vivo evidence for potentially existing ubiquitin-protein conjugates. The experiments show that the recpp89 protein is rapidly degraded in vitro by the 20S proteasomes and that the correct MHC class I pp89 epitope or its 11mer precursor are generated with high fidelity. Furthermore, CTL assays, indicating the generation of the specific pp89 epitope or the 11mer precursor, also suggested a 26S proteasome-dependent degradation of the mCMV pp89-ODC fusion protein in the presence of antizyme. Treating cell cultures with proteasome inhibitors resulted in a significant accumulation of ubiquitin-conjugates in vivo. However, higher molecular weight pp89-ubiquitin conjugates were not detectable throughout the entire experimental set-up. Consequently, a proteasome-dependent, but ubiquitin-independent pathway can be postulated for the generation of viral epitopes.

Suppressor of Cytokine Signaling (SOCS)1 and SOCS3 Stimulation during Experimental Cytomegalovirus Retinitis: Virologic, Immunologic, or Pathologic Mechanisms

Alston, Christine I. 06 January 2017 (has links)
AIDS-related human cytomegalovirus (HCMV) retinitis remains the leading cause of blindness among untreated HIV/AIDS patients worldwide. Understanding the pathogenesis of this disease is essential for developing new, safe, and effective treatments for its prevention or management, yet much remains unknown about the virologic and immunologic mechanisms contributing to its pathology. To study such mechanisms, we use a well-established, reproducible, and clinically relevant animal model with retrovirus-induced murine acquired immunodeficiency syndrome (MAIDS) that mimics in mice the symptoms and progression of AIDS in humans. Over 8 to 12 weeks, MAIDS mice become susceptible to experimental murine cytomegalovirus (MCMV) retinitis. We have found in this model that MCMV infection significantly stimulates ocular suppressor of cytokine signaling (SOCS)1 and SOCS3, host proteins which dampen immune-related signaling by cytokines, including antiviral interferons. Herein we investigated virologic and/or immunologic mechanisms involved in this stimulation and how virally-modulated SOCS1 and/or SOCS3 proteins may contribute to MCMV infection or experimental MAIDS-related MCMV retinitis. Through pursuit of two specific aims, we tested the central hypothesis that MCMV stimulates and employs SOCS1 and/or SOCS3 to induce the onset and development of MCMV retinal disease. MCMV-related SOCS1 and SOCS3 stimulation in vivo occurred with intraocular infection, was dependent on method and stage of immune suppression and severity of ocular pathology, was associated with stimulation of SOCS-inducing cytokines, and SOCS1 and SOCS3 were differentially sensitive to antiviral treatment. In vitro studies further demonstrated that SOCS1 and SOCS3 stimulation during MCMV infection occurred with expected immediate early kinetics, required viral gene expression in cell-type-dependent and virus origin-dependent patterns of expression, and displayed differential sensitivity to antiviral treatment. These data suggest that SOCS1 and SOCS3 are stimulated by divergent virologic, immunologic, and/or pathologic mechanisms during MCMV infection, and that they contribute to the pathogenesis of retinal disease, revealing new insights into the pathophysiology of AIDS-related HCMV retinitis.

O valor do dinheiro no tempo: uma avaliação de empreendimentos do Programa Minha Casa Minha Vida - Faixa 1 / The time value of money: a valuation of enterprises of Program \"Minha Casa Minha Vida - Faixa 1

Guaritá, Gabriela Darini 18 June 2018 (has links)
Esta dissertação analisa a produção de moradias sociais direcionada às famílias de baixa renda no âmbito do Programa Minha Casa Minha Vida. Partindo dos principais índices econômico-financeiros utilizados em negócios imobiliários, a pesquisa revela as alterações do comportamento do mercado da construção civil do ramo habitacional na avaliação da rentabilidade do capital próprio enquanto aplicado nesse segmento. Baseada em estudos de caso, a pesquisa obteve acesso ao cronograma financeiro global das obras, bem como do Quadro de Composição de Investimento (QCI) e da Ficha de Resumo dos Empreendimentos (FRE), documentos obrigatórios na contratação das unidades junto à CEF. Somados às entrevistas com os agentes envolvidos, procurou-se elucidar as estratégias de expansão do capital imobiliário amparada pelo entendimento do desenvolvimento de uma viabilidade técnico financeira. Inicialmente, a proposta dessa pesquisa focava na análise do desempenho operacional e financeiro de dois empreendimentos construídos na cidade de Taboão da Serra, localizados lado a lado, e produzidos por duas modalidades do programa (Empresas x Entidades). No entanto, o empreendimento articulado pela entidade organizadora: o Movimento dos Trabalhadores Sem Teto (MTST), construído através de Empreitada Global, apresenta algumas similaridades com o empreendimento vizinho ao que se refere às estratégias de produção e de valorização do capital imobiliário. Diante disso, para complementar a análise da modalidade Entidades, a pesquisa avaliou os Condomínios Florestan Fernandes e José Maria Amaral, constituídos de fato por meio de autogestão direta. Nota-se com a aplicação desses métodos (fundamentados nos conceitos do valor do dinheiro no tempo), a reprodução de algumas práticas das grandes incorporadoras, inclusive na modalidade Entidades. Além disso, o desenho operacional do programa expõe os movimentos sociais às mudanças políticas econômicas e ao entendimento de técnicas financeiras complexas em função do longo prazo de maturação dos empreendimentos. / This dissertation analyzes the production of social housing directed to low-income families in the program \"Minha Casa, Minha Vida\". Based on the main economic-financial indexes used in real estate deals, the research reveals the changes in the behavior of civil construction housing market in the evaluation of the profitability of capital while applied in this segment. Based on case studies, the research obtained access to the overall financial schedule of the construction works, as well as the Investment Composition Framework (QCI) and the Summary of Enterprises Project (RES), mandatory documents for contracting the units with CEF. In addition to the interviews with the agents involved, it was sought to elucidate the mechanisms for the expansion of real estate capital, based on the understanding of the development of a technical financial viability. Initially, the proposal of this research was to compare the operational and financial performance of the two enterprises located in the city of Taboão da Serra, side by side, and produced from different modalities of the program (Companies vs. Entities). However, the enterprise articulated for the organizing entity: the \"Movimento dos Trabalhadores Sem Teto\" (MTST), built through the \"Empreitada Global\", presents some similarities with the neighboring building venture, as far as the strategies of production and valorization of the real estate capital are concerned. In view of this, to complement the analysis of the Entities modality, the survey evaluated the \"Florestan Fernandes\" and \"José Maria Amaral\" Condominiums, constituted in fact through direct self - management. Notice with the application of these methods (based on the concepts of the value of money in time), the reproduction of some practices of the great real estate developers, including the Entities modality. In addition, the operational design of the program exposes social movements to economic policy changes and the understanding of complex financial techniques as a function of the long-term maturity of ventures.

Regulation des Zellzyklus durch das Maus- und Ratten-Zytomegalievirus

Neuwirth, Anke 29 November 2005 (has links)
Das humane Zytomegalievirus, ist ein ubiquitäres Pathogen, welches akute und persistierende Infektionen verursacht. Bei immunsupprimierten Patienten kann das Virus zu schweren Erkrankungen, wie Hepatitis, Pneumonie und bei kongenitaler Infektion außerdem zu Schädigungen des ZNS führen. HCMV blockiert die Zellproliferation durch einen Arrest am G1/S-Übergang des Zellzyklus, andererseits wird aber gleichzeitig die Expression S-Phase spezifischer Gene aktiviert. Teilweise lässt sich dies durch eine Virus vermittelte spezifische Inhibition der zellulären DNA-Repliaktion sowie durch eine massive Deregulation Zyklin-assozzierter Kinasen erklären. Zellkulturexperimente deuten darauf hin, dass die Zellzyklusalterationen wichtige Voraussetzungen für eine erfolgreiche Virusreplikation darstellen. Es ist hingegen nicht bekannt, welche Relevanz sie für die Virusvermehrung in vivo und das pathologische Erscheinungsbild im erkrankten Organismus besitzen. Diese Frage kann nur in einem Tiermodell sinnvoll angegangen werden. Aufgrund der Wirtsspezifität der Zytomegalieviren, ist man dabei auf die Verwendung der jeweiligen artspezifischen CMV angewiesen. Murines CMV (MCMV) und Ratten-CMV (RCMV) sind dabei die bislang bestuntersuchtesten Systeme. Das Anliegen dieser Arbeit war es zu prüfen, inwieweit die für HCMV beschriebenen Zellzyklusregulationen in MCMV und RCMV auf Zellkulturbasis konserviert sind. Es konnte gezeigt werden, dass sowohl RCMV als auch MCMV einen antiproliferativen Effekt auf infizierte Zellen besitzen und ebenso wie HCMV zu einem Zellzyklusarrest führen. Nager-Zytomegalieviren können Zellen auch in der G2-Phase arretieren und in dieser Zellzyklusphase auch effizient replizieren können. Die Infektion mit Nager-CMV führt außerdem auf breiter Basis zur Veränderung Zyklin-assoziierter Kinaseaktivitäten. Allen Zytomegalieviren ist die Hemmung der zellulären DNA-Synthese am G1/S-Übergang durch die Inhibition des replication licensing, dem Beginn der DNA-Synthese gemein. Durch diese vergleichende Studie wird einerseits deutlich, dass wesentliche funktionelle Schritte der Zellzyklusregulation zwischen den Zytomegalieviren konserviert sind, aber andererseits die zu Grunde liegenden molekularen Mechanismen zum Teil deutlich variieren. / Human Cytomegalovirus (HCMV) is an ubiquitous, species-specific beta-herpesvirus that, like other herpesviruses, can establish lifelong latency following primary infection. HCMV infection becomes virulent only in immunocompromised patients such as premature infants, transplant recipients and AIDS patients where the virus causes severe disease like hepatitis, pneumonitis and retinitis. Congenital infection produces birth defects, most commonly hearing loss. To develop rational-based strategies for prevention and treatment of HCMV infection, it is crucial to understand the interactions between the virus and its host cell that support the establishment and progression of the virus replicative cycle. In general, herpesviruses are known to replicate most efficiently in the absence of cellular DNA synthesis. What is more, they have evolved mechanisms to avoid the cell´s DNA replication phase by blocking cell cycle progression outside S phase. HCMV has been shown to specifically inhibit the onset of cellular DNA synthesis resulting in cells arrested with a G1 DNA content. Towards a better understanding of CMV-mediated cell cycle alterations in vivo, we tested murine and rat CMV (MCMV/RCMV), being common animal models for CMV infection, for their influence on the host cell cycle. It was found that both MCMV and RCMV exhibit a strong anti-proliferative capacity on immortalised and primary embryonic fibroblasts after lytic infection. This results from specific cell cycle blocks in G1 and G2 as demonstrated by flow cytometry analysis. The G1 arrest is at least in part caused by a specific inhibition of cellular DNA synthesis and involves both the formation and activation of the cells’ DNA replication machinery. Interestingly, and in contrast to HCMV, the replicative cycle of rodent CMVs started from G2 as efficiently as from G1. Whilst the cell cycle arrest is accompanied by a broad induction of cyclin-cdk2 and cyclin-cdk1 activity, cyclin D1-cdk4/6 activity is selectively suppressed in MCMV and RCMV infected cells. Thus, given that both rodent and human CMVs are anti-proliferative and arrest cell cycle progression we found a surprising divergence of some of the underlying mechanisms. Therefore, any question put forward to a rodent CMV model involving cell cycle regulation has to be well defined in order to extrapolate meaningful information for the human system.
